Title: Delay-Dependent Robust H/sub ∞/ Filtering for Time-Delay Systems with Markov Jumps
Authors: Lu, Chien-Yu;Tsai, Jason S. H.;Su, T. J.

Abstract: This paper deals with the problem of robust H/sub ∞/ filtering for a class of jump linear continuous-time systems with delay dependence. The problem aims at designing a stable linear filtering assuring asymptotic stability and a prescribed H/sub ∞/ performance level for the filtering error system, respective of the time delays. A sufficient condition for the existence of such a filter is developed in terms of linear matrix inequalities. A numerical example demonstrates the validity of the theoretical results.
